Game Recap: Women's Basketball |

Minnesota State Extends Winning Streak to Six with 88-69 win at Winona State Thursday

Winona, Minn. --- Rated #6 in this week's national poll, Minnesota State collected its six consecutive win and the second NSIC win on the season with an 88-69 league road win at Winona State Thursday.

With the win, MSU improves to 6-0 (2-0 NSIC), while WSU drops to 7-1 (1-1 NSIC) on the season.

The Mavericks, who never trailed in the game, finished the first quarter owning a 26-15 lead over the Warriors.

Freshman Natalie Bremer's 15 points in the first half helped the visiting Mavericks to a 53-40 lead, while junior Taylor Theusch netted 14 points, shooting four out of seven three-pointers.

The Warriors outscored the Mavericks 14-5 at the start of the third quarter in cutting the Minnesota State lead to seven points (61-54) but MSU rallied and owned a 65-54 advantage at the end of the third period.

Junior guard Joey Batt netted eight points in the fourth quarter as the Mavericks pulled away for the 88-69 win.

Bremer, who was eight-of-13 from the field, finished with a career-high 21 points in the game. Junior Joey Batt racked up 21 points, pulled in two rebounds and finished the game with two steals. Theusch scored a career-high 20 points and made six three-pointers in 13 attempts.   Sophomore Destinee Bursch scored 14 points, and had three rebounds, and four assists. 

As a unit, Minnesota State shot 43.5% from the field and scored 20 points off turnovers. They also passed out 13 assists and recorded 28 rebounds and 10 steals. 
 

Minnesota State continues its season at home this Saturday hosting Upper Iowa at Taylor Center. Tip-off is scheduled for 2:00 p.m.
